As a Spinal MSK Practitioner, you will lead the transformation of spinal care across the region. Working within our advanced practice‑led interface service and Single Point of Access (SPOA), you will be responsible for managing complex spinal caseloads, making autonomous clinical decisions, and collaborating with spinal surgeons, pain specialists and MDTs to deliver seamless, patient‑centred care.
- Triage and prioritisation of complex spinal referrals, especially for patients at risk of work loss.
- Advanced diagnostics and clinical reasoning including MRI, X‑rays and bloods.
- Service development – pathway redesign and integration aligned with GIRFT and the National Back Pain Pathway.
- Clinical leadership – mentoring IMSK staff and supporting CPD.
- Research, audit and quality improvement to shape future spinal services.
The role of the Spinal MSK Practitioner is multifaceted, encompassing service delivery, clinical leadership, practice development, education, research and professional growth. The post holder will play a key role in supporting the development and integration of a Single Point of Access (SPOA) for spinal patients in North Cumbria, aligned with the National Back Pain Pathway, GIRFT guidance and the existing IMSK advanced practice‑led interface service.
The overarching aim is for the Spinal MSK Practitioner to lead and support the SPOA, ensuring the delivery of cost‑effective, efficient and high‑quality services that meet the needs of patients with spinal conditions.
